Another myth about the use of sauna is that it leads to weight loss. It is possible to lose about a pound after using a sauna, but weight loss is due to fluid loss, not fat. The weight will be replaced as soon as a person eats or drinks something.

A leg cramp feels like a clenched, contracted muscle tightened into a knot. It can be severely uncomfortable, painful or even unbearable. Your muscles in the area might hurt for hours after the cramp goes away.

Not always, but chronic alcohol consumption often leads to dehydration due to alcohol’s diuretic effect, which increases urine production and fluid loss. The color of urine serves as a reliable indicator of hydration status, with dark urine signaling dehydration in heavy drinkers. A healthy urine color should be pale yellow, resembling straw.

Mild enzyme elevation from dehydration is generally not a cause for alarm if hydration improves promptly. However, persistently high levels warrant medical evaluation to rule out other causes of liver does wine dehydrate you stress or damage. Human case reports also confirm mild enzyme spikes after episodes of intense fluid loss such as prolonged diarrhea or heat exhaustion. However, these elevations rarely exceed moderate levels unless complicated by other factors like infection or drug toxicity.
